Referência da API REST do Service Fabric Resource Manager

O Service Fabric é uma plataforma de sistemas distribuídos que facilita o empacotamento, a implementação e a gestão de microsserviços dimensionáveis e fiáveis.

Um cluster do Service Fabric é um conjunto ligado à rede de máquinas virtuais ou físicas no qual os seus microsserviços são implementados e geridos. As APIs Resource Manager do Service Fabric permitem-lhe criar e gerir clusters do Service Fabric no Azure.

Segue-se uma lista de APIs REST Resource Manager do Service Fabric.


Cluster APIs

Nome Descrição
Get Obtém um recurso de cluster do Service Fabric.
Criar Cria ou atualiza um recurso de cluster do Service Fabric.
Atualizar Atualizações a configuração de um recurso de cluster do Service Fabric.
Eliminar Elimina um recurso de cluster do Service Fabric.
Listar por Grupo de Recursos Obtém a lista de recursos de cluster do Service Fabric criados no grupo de recursos especificado.
Lista Obtém a lista de recursos de cluster do Service Fabric criados na subscrição especificada.

ClusterVersion APIs

Nome Descrição
Get Obtém informações sobre uma versão de código de cluster do Service Fabric disponível na localização especificada.
Obter Por Ambiente Obtém informações sobre uma versão de código de cluster do Service Fabric disponível para o ambiente especificado.
Lista Obtém a lista de versões de código do cluster do Service Fabric disponíveis para a localização especificada.
Listar por Ambiente Obtém a lista de versões de código do cluster do Service Fabric disponíveis para o ambiente especificado.

APIs de operações

Nome Descrição
Lista Lista todas as operações de API do fornecedor de recursos do Service Fabric disponíveis.

Modelos

Nome Descrição
AddOnFeatures enum As funcionalidades de suplemento de cluster disponíveis.

- RepairManager - O serviço Service Fabric Repair Manager .
- DnsService - O serviço DNS do Service Fabric .
- BackupRestoreService - O serviço de Cópia de Segurança e Restauro do Service Fabric .
- ResourceMonitorService - O serviço Monitor de Recursos do Service Fabric.
ApplicationDeltaHealthPolicy Define uma política de estado de funcionamento delta utilizada para avaliar o estado de funcionamento de uma aplicação ou uma das entidades subordinadas ao atualizar o cluster.
ApplicationHealthPolicy Define uma política de estado de funcionamento utilizada para avaliar o estado de funcionamento de uma aplicação ou de uma das entidades subordinadas.
AvailableOperationDisplay Operação suportada pelo fornecedor de recursos do Service Fabric
AzureActiveDirectory As definições para ativar a autenticação do AAD no cluster.
CertificateDescription Descreve os detalhes do certificado.
ClientCertificateCommonName Descreve os detalhes do certificado de cliente com o nome comum.
ClientCertificateThumbprint Descreve os detalhes do certificado de cliente com o thumbprint.
Cluster O recurso do cluster
ClusterCodeVersionsListResult Os resultados da lista das versões de runtime do Service Fabric.
ClusterCodeVersionsResult O resultado das versões de runtime do Service Fabric
ClusterHealthPolicy Define uma política de estado de funcionamento utilizada para avaliar o estado de funcionamento do cluster ou de um nó de cluster.
ClusterListResult Resultados da lista de clusters
ClusterProperties Descreve as propriedades dos recursos do cluster.
ClusterPropertiesUpdateParameters Descreve as propriedades de recursos do cluster que podem ser atualizadas durante a operação PATCH.
ClusterUpdateParameters Pedido de atualização do cluster
ClusterUpgradeDeltaHealthPolicy Descreve as políticas de estado de funcionamento delta para a atualização do cluster.
ClusterUpgradePolicy Descreve a política utilizada ao atualizar o cluster.
ClusterVersionDetails O detalhe do resultado da versão do runtime do Service Fabric
DiagnosticsStorageAccountConfig As informações da conta de armazenamento para armazenar registos de diagnóstico do Service Fabric.
EndpointRangeDescription Detalhes do intervalo de portas
ErrorModel A estrutura do erro.
ErrorModelError Os detalhes do erro.
NodeTypeDescription Descreve um tipo de nó no cluster. Cada tipo de nó representa um subconjunto de nós no cluster.
OperationListResult Descreve o resultado do pedido para listar as operações do fornecedor de recursos do Service Fabric.
OperationResult Resultado da lista de operações disponível
Enumeração ProvisioningState Os valores possíveis incluem: "A atualizar", "Com Êxito", "Com Falhas", "Cancelado"
Recurso A definição do modelo de recurso.
ServerCertificateCommonName Descreve os detalhes do certificado do servidor com o nome comum.
ServerCertificateCommonNames Descreve uma lista de certificados de servidor referenciados pelo nome comum que são utilizados para proteger o cluster.
ServiceTypeDeltaHealthPolicy Representa a política de estado de funcionamento delta utilizada para avaliar o estado de funcionamento dos serviços pertencentes a um tipo de serviço ao atualizar o cluster.
ServiceTypeHealthPolicy Representa a política de estado de funcionamento utilizada para avaliar o estado de funcionamento dos serviços pertencentes a um tipo de serviço.
DefiniçõesParameterDescription Descreve um parâmetro nas definições de recursos de infraestrutura do cluster.
SettingsSectionDescription Descreve uma secção nas definições de recursos de infraestrutura do cluster.